The Office of the President

Mr. Thomas W. Poore, M.Ed. - President

 

The John Paul II High School community has been led by Mr. Thomas W. Poore, President, since 2003. Mr. Poore graduated from St. Edwards University in Austin in 1973, received a Master’s in Education from Stephen F. Austin University in 1977, and spent many years serving the Texas public school system, from which he retired in 2003. From his career in public schools, Mr. Poore brings to John Paul II High School broad experience, ranging from classroom teacher to principal to Interim Superintendent.


Dedicated to young people, Mr. Poore sets a tone driven by ‘in the interest of children.’ He believes in fostering strong rapport with students, parents, and faculty and can often be found in the hallways, classrooms, and dining hall, visiting with the exceptional young people who make up the JPIIHS student body. Deliberate decisions, which place the interests of the students above all others, guide the school community. Mr. Poore believes in setting an example of combined compassion and leadership; this in turn is reflected by what our students are equipped to do upon graduation: make a difference in the world by walking in the footsteps of Pope John Paul II.
